Selling Your New Albany Home: Complete Timing and Pricing Guide

Understanding the New Albany Real Estate Market Landscape

The New Albany real estate market presents unique opportunities for sellers who understand local trends and buyer behavior. Before listing your home, it's crucial to analyze the current market conditions, inventory levels, and buyer demographics in the area.

Current Market Conditions

New Albany's real estate market has experienced steady growth over recent years, with increasing demand from both local buyers and those relocating from surrounding areas. The market is characterized by a healthy balance between supply and demand, making it an opportune time for sellers who price their homes competitively and present them effectively.

Key factors influencing the market include:

  • Population growth - New Albany continues to attract families and professionals seeking a small-town lifestyle with modern amenities
  • School district reputation - Excellent schools drive demand among families with children
  • Economic development - Local business growth creates job opportunities and attracts new residents
  • Proximity to larger cities - Easy access to Oxford and other regional centers appeals to commuters

Seasonal Trends and Timing

Timing your home sale strategically can significantly impact your final sale price. Spring and early summer typically see increased buyer activity, though New Albany's market remains relatively active year-round compared to many regions.

The best time to sell generally aligns with when you have a well-prepared home and the market conditions favor sellers. However, understanding seasonal patterns helps you optimize your listing strategy.

Preparing Your Home for Sale: Essential Upgrades and Curb Appeal

Critical Home Improvements

Strategic upgrades can significantly increase your home's market value and appeal to potential buyers. Focus on improvements that offer the best return on investment:

  • Kitchen updates - Modern appliances, fresh paint, and updated countertops appeal to buyers
  • Bathroom renovations - New fixtures and finishes create a perception of quality and cleanliness
  • Flooring - Refinished hardwood or new carpet can transform a home's appearance
  • Roof and HVAC - Ensure these critical systems are in excellent condition
  • Fresh paint - Neutral colors appeal to a broader range of buyers

Curb Appeal Essentials

First impressions matter tremendously in real estate. Your home's exterior is the first thing potential buyers see, and it sets the tone for their entire viewing experience.

A well-maintained exterior can increase perceived home value by up to 10% before buyers even step inside.

Focus on these curb appeal elements:

  • Landscaping and lawn maintenance
  • Fresh exterior paint or stain
  • Updated front door and hardware
  • Clean driveway and walkways
  • Proper lighting and welcoming entrance
  • Well-maintained roof and gutters

Interior Staging and Presentation

Staging your home helps buyers envision themselves living there. Remove personal items, declutter spaces, and arrange furniture to highlight your home's best features. Neutral décor and clean, bright spaces appeal to the widest audience of potential buyers.

Pricing Strategies and Competitive Analysis for New Albany Properties

Conducting a Comparative Market Analysis

Accurate pricing is fundamental to a successful sale. A comparative market analysis (CMA) examines recently sold homes similar to yours in location, size, condition, and features.

Key data points to analyze:

  • Sale prices of comparable homes in your neighborhood
  • Days on market for similar properties
  • List-to-sale price ratios
  • Current active listings and their asking prices
  • Homes that didn't sell and why

Setting the Right Price

Pricing too high can result in your home sitting on the market, while pricing too low leaves money on the table. The optimal price attracts serious buyers quickly while maximizing your return.

Consider working with a local real estate professional who understands New Albany's specific market dynamics. They can provide data-driven recommendations based on current conditions and buyer behavior patterns.

Pricing Psychology and Market Positioning

Strategic pricing uses psychological principles to attract more buyers. Pricing just below round numbers (e.g., $249,900 instead of $250,000) often generates more interest and showings, potentially leading to competitive offers.

Marketing Your Home and Closing the Sale Successfully

Effective Marketing Strategies

In today's digital-first market, comprehensive marketing is essential for reaching qualified buyers quickly.

  • Professional photography and videography - High-quality visuals are crucial for online listings
  • Online presence - List on major real estate platforms and local websites
  • Social media marketing - Leverage Facebook, Instagram, and other platforms to reach potential buyers
  • Open houses - Host well-organized open houses to generate interest and foot traffic
  • Direct mail campaigns - Target specific neighborhoods with marketing materials
  • Agent networks - Utilize your agent's professional connections to reach other agents and their clients

Showing Your Home Effectively

Each showing is an opportunity to make a positive impression. Ensure your home is clean, well-lit, and welcoming. Remove pets during showings, eliminate cooking odors, and create a neutral, pleasant environment that allows buyers to imagine their own lives in the space.

Negotiating and Closing

When offers arrive, evaluate them carefully beyond just the price. Consider the buyer's financing, contingencies, and proposed timeline. Be prepared to negotiate terms that work for your situation.

Final steps to a successful closing:

  • Work with a qualified real estate attorney
  • Ensure all inspections and appraisals are completed promptly
  • Maintain open communication with all parties
  • Address any issues that arise during the inspection period
  • Prepare for the final walkthrough and closing meeting

Maximizing Your Success

Selling your New Albany home successfully requires attention to detail, strategic planning, and market knowledge. By understanding your local market, preparing your home thoroughly, pricing competitively, and marketing effectively, you'll position yourself to attract serious buyers and achieve your sales goals.

Remember that every home and situation is unique. Working with experienced local professionals who understand New Albany's specific market conditions can provide invaluable guidance throughout the selling process and help you make informed decisions at every step.
